Beautiful and Brazen, Huge and Hidden Contemporary art from China is the hottest property in the art world right now. For a long time, the capital Beijing dominated the scene. Now Shanghai has emerged from its shadows as a truly world-class art destination. All across the city, public galleries have sprung up and played a pivotal role in regenerating dilapidated industrial areas. The scene is not just for serious art buffs.
